One of Scandinavia's foremost paper producers has announced a significant reduction in its workforce, citing declining demand in the latter half of the year and ongoing economic challenges. The decision impacts the company's facility in Bäckhammar, where multiple employees are expected to be affected by the restructuring measures.
The company has attributed the need for these layoffs to a noticeable decrease in market demand for paper products over recent months, coupled with persistent cost pressures affecting the manufacturing sector. These challenges have compelled management to initiate a comprehensive review of operational activities, with the aim of ensuring long-term sustainability and competitiveness.
According to statements released by the company, the decline in demand has been particularly pronounced during the second half of the year. This trend aligns with broader shifts in the global paper industry, as digitalization and changing consumption patterns continue to reshape traditional markets. The organization has emphasized that the decision to reduce staff was not taken lightly and forms part of a larger strategy to adapt to evolving economic conditions.
In addition to market-driven factors, the company faces rising operational costs, including energy, raw materials, and logistics expenses. These increases have exerted further pressure on profit margins and necessitated a thorough reassessment of production volumes and staff requirements. The company has committed to supporting affected employees throughout the transition period, providing information about available resources and assistance options.
Local community leaders and industry analysts have expressed concerns regarding the broader implications of the layoffs. The Bäckhammar facility is a significant employer in the region, and reductions in its workforce are expected to have ripple effects on the local economy. Stakeholders are closely monitoring developments and evaluating measures to mitigate the impact on employees and the surrounding community.
Industry experts note that the current situation reflects longstanding trends within the paper sector, as companies adapt to global market fluctuations and changing consumer habits. Many producers have implemented similar measures in response to decreased demand for traditional paper products, the rise of digital alternatives, and increasing production costs.
